Output e0001bbcfe595c488f810eccef81aac46fec54ee19d063f31b996183a7effa2e:4

value
709210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8358b6e8a4c700ce5bd50094c20a2460895f00da OP_EQUAL
address
3DfWifUZevUBBCQvGDv25WdA8Kqm9Xsvwy
transaction
e0001bbcfe595c488f810eccef81aac46fec54ee19d063f31b996183a7effa2e
spent
true